Description

Rhamnazin 3-Isorhamninoside is a specialized flavonoid glycoside compound, identified by CAS NO 52801-23-7. This high-purity phytochemical is valued for its role as a key reference standard and active research compound in life science applications. It is primarily sought by manufacturers and research institutions in the pharmaceutical, nutraceutical, and cosmetic industries for product development and analytical purposes.

Application

  • Pharmaceutical Reference Standard: Used for the identification, purity assessment, and quantification of related flavonoid compounds in drug development and quality control (QC/QA) laboratories.
  • Nutraceutical & Functional Food Research: Serves as a bioactive ingredient for studying potential health benefits, antioxidant properties, and formulation stability in dietary supplements.
  • Cosmetic & Skincare Actives: Investigated for its potential antioxidant and skin-protective properties in the development of advanced cosmetic formulations.
  • Biochemical & Pharmacological Studies: Employed in vitro and in vivo research to explore mechanisms of action, bioavailability, and metabolic pathways.
  • Analytical Chemistry: Utilized as a calibration standard in High-Performance Liquid Chromatography (HPLC), Liquid Chromatography-Mass Spectrometry (LC-MS), and other chromatographic methods.

Basic Information

Product Name Rhamnazin 3-Isorhamninoside
CAS No. 52801-23-7
Molecular Formula C34H42O20
Molecular Weight 770.69 g/mol
Synonyms Rhamnazin 3-O-isorhamninoside; 3',5-Dihydroxy-3,4',7-trimethoxyflavone 3-isorhamninoside; 5-Hydroxy-3',4',7-trimethoxyflavone 3-O-α-L-rhamnopyranosyl-(1→6)-β-D-glucopyranoside; Kaempferol 3-isorhamninoside derivative; Flavonol glycoside; Rhamnazin triglycoside

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at 2-8°C for long-term stability. This compound is light-sensitive and easily oxidized; for optimal preservation, consider storage under an inert atmosphere such as argon or nitrogen.
